Guest Speaker: Prof.Matthew Turk

Matt Turk is a researcher at the National Center for Supercomputing Applications (NCSA), working on tools and techniques for data analysis and visualization, and applying those techniques both to astrophysical studies such as star formation as well as other domains in the physical sciences. He is interested in semantic understanding of data, interdisciplinary work systems and technical transfer between domains, as well as mechanisms for constructing interfaces to data and computational systems.

Next Meeting Wednesday 9/21 – 12pm Special Guest. Dr.Maryalice Wu

drwu

Maryalice is the Director of Data Analytics at the Center for Innovation in Teaching and Learning department and an adjunct assistant professor in the Department of Sociology. She has a Ph.D. in Sociology from UIUC and has been working in the field of data analytics since 1999. Her recent research focuses on the impact of MOOCS (Massive Open Online Courses). Her additional research includes the economic and health empowerment of women in developing nations. She has taught several courses at the UofI, including Introduction to Social Statistics and Social Research Methods.
